As you grow older, staying active is crucial for maintaining your physical condition. Regular exercise can improve your strength, flexibility, and coordination, helping you go about your daily activities with confidence.

Here are some fitness tips that can support seniors like you stay active and thrive:

* Start slow and gradually increase the intensity of your workouts over time.

* Find activities you enjoy, whether it's walking, swimming, dancing, or gardening.

* Listen to your body and take rest days when needed.

* Consult with your doctor before starting a new exercise program, especially if you have any underlying health conditions.

Staying active doesn't just benefit your physical health; it can also improve your mental well-being by reducing stress, boosting mood, and promoting better sleep. So get moving today and enjoy the many rewards of a healthy and active lifestyle!

Strengthen Your Strength & Balance: Senior-Friendly Exercises

As we age, it's natural for our strength and balance to wither. But that doesn't mean we have to tolerate to these changes!

Regular exercise can significantly strengthen both your strength and balance, helping you maintain your independence and live a more fulfilling life. Here are some senior-specific exercises to get you started:

* Strolling: This classic exercise is great for building cardiovascular health and developing leg muscles.

* Gentle yoga: This modified form of yoga strengthens flexibility, balance, and core strength while being gentle on your joints.

* Mindfulness exercises: These practices combine slow, flowing movements with deep breathing to improve balance, coordination, and minimize stress.

Remember to speak with your doctor before starting any new exercise program. And most importantly, have fun! Becoming active should be enjoyable and rewarding.
